machoism
Noun
/ˈmɑː.tʃoʊ.ɪ.zəm/

Definition
Machoism is a cultural attitude of extremeness of masculinity characterized by assertiveness, dominance, and an aversion to anything perceived as feminine or weak.

Examples
- His machoism often made it difficult for him to express vulnerability.
- Some cultures celebrate machoism, associating it with strength and leadership.
- Machoism can negatively impact relationships by promoting unhealthy stereotypes.

Meaning
The term refers to behaviors or beliefs that emphasize traditional male roles and attributes, often leading to the oppression or devaluation of the feminine.
